With over two decades of experience in DEI leadership development and intercultural learning, Shilpa Alimchandani, author of Communicating Development Across Cultures: Monologues and Dialogues in Development Project Implementation, is a leadership coach, instructional designer, and facilitator. In her independent consulting practice, she is passionate about helping her clients tackle issues related to diversity, equity and inclusion to achieve transformational change. In this third episode of our seven-part series on the learning business in disruptive times, Celisa talks with return-guest, Shilpa about DEI, including what it is, ways it’s being impacted by disruption, and how it relates to implicit bias. They also discuss the importance of unlearning and what learning businesses need to know about supporting DEI and succeeding in these disruptive times.
